Beth is a founding partner of Hepburn + Glass Lawyers + Mediators, co-founded in 2019 with Danielle Glass. With nearly two decades of experience, she specializes in family law and is also a certified mediator and arbitrator. Beth earned her law degree from the University of Saskatchewan and holds a Bachelor of Arts from the University of Victoria, where she completed a double major in History and English. Prior to law school, she lived abroad in Asia, gaining a global perspective that continues to inform her approach to client service and communication.
She began her legal career clerking for several justices of the BC Supreme Court before articling at a respected downtown Vancouver law firm. Since then, she has appeared before all levels of court in British Columbia, building a reputation for offering clear, practical advice and communicating complex legal issues in plain language.
While family law is her primary focus, Beth also provides assistance with wills, estate planning, and related litigation matters, ensuring clients receive comprehensive support throughout their most personal legal challenges.
Having grown up in White Rock, Beth returned to the community with her family in 2009.
